CBD hash is a product made of industrially processed hemp that's grown for its high levels of CBD. It has little to no tetrahydrocannabinol (THC) and is legal in all 50 states.
It's made from hemp
CBD hemp hash is produced from the resin that's produced by the hemp plant. It's also referred to as hashish and it's a concentrate of the cannabis plant that is rich in cannabinoids, terpenes, and flavonoids.

Hash is a sticky concentrate that's derived from the resin glands of industrial hemp plants. It's full of from terpenes and cannabinoids to flavonoids, and other natural compounds produced by hemp plants.
The process of making hash is to rub or pressing the glands of resin together, which results in it becoming sticky. It's usually either chocolate brown or sand brown in color, and it can have an aroma that is sweet.
This is a product made from hemp plants that contain less than 0.3 percent THC. This is the legal limit in the United States for this product to be sold. Hemp strains like Berry Blossom and Cherry Wine, T1 or T2, and Sour Diesel produce high-quality CBD hemp hash.

This type of concentrate comes from hemp plants and contains less than 0.3 percent THC. It's legal in the majority of states that regulate the consumption of marijuana.
It is a solid concentration of trichomes or cannabis resin glands. The color can range from light blonde to dark brown. It is usually taken in a dab or a puff however it can also be mixed with flowers.
This concentrate is a mixture of flavonoids and cannabinoids, which have therapeutic effects. These can include a number of different health benefits, including pain relief, anxiety management, and improved sleep.
A variety of CBD-rich hemp varieties are used to make this concentrate, which is made by separating and pressing sticky trichomes of hemp flowers. This makes a high-quality, natural product that has all the benefits of hemp.
